What the job involves

  • They are experts in components of the MongoDB ecosystem - database server, drivers, our management suite, and services such as Cloud Manager (the online product we developed for customers for automation, backup, monitoring, and analysis of their MongoDB systems), and MongoDB Atlas
  • They combine their MongoDB expertise with passion, initiative, teamwork and a great sense of humor to achieve exceptional results for our customers
  • MongoDB is on a mission to change the way people think about databases
  • Along the way, our customers encounter questions and issues about how our approach to databases works for their use cas
  • In Technical Services, it's our job to help these people
  • You'll be working alongside our largest customers, solving their complex challenges - resolving questions on architecture, performance, recovery, security, and everything in between
  • You'll be an expert resource on best practices in running MongoDB at scale, whatever that scale may be
  • You'll be an advocate for customers' needs - interfacing with our product management and development teams on their behalf
  • And you'll contribute to internal projects, including software development of support tools for performance, benchmarking, and diagnostics
  • Finally, MongoDB Technical Services puts a strong focus on engineers enabling their peers to be successful by sharing newly gained technical knowledge with the team, either via informal one-to-one conversations, or training and workshop sessions
  • By documenting solutions in our knowledge base system, Technical Services Engineers will increase the efficiency of our customers, other team members and departments throughout MongoDB
  • In 3 months, you’ll have gained a deep understanding of MongoDB and its ecosystem. You will complete New Hire Training
  • In 6 months, you will be comfortable working directly with our customers. You will also complete the MongoDB Certified DBA Associate exam
  • In 12 months, you will work on gaining expertise to be a part of a technical experts group within the MongoDB ecosystem and will be helping your peer engineers in advance diagnostics. Also, you will be encouraged to handle technical escalations independently

Our take

MongoDB is an open-source, cross-platform, document-oriented database system. It stores data as JSON-like documents and is written in C++, Go, JavaScript and Python.

Essentially, the company develops tools and blueprints to help businesses and organisations modernise their legacy applications, migrating them to the MongoDB database and the MongoDB Atlas cloud database. With this initiative, MongoDB is particularly taking aim at Oracle customers with ageing applications running on the Oracle relational database system.

Since its release, MongoDB has become one of the most popularly used NoSQL database systems due to its ease of use and efficiency. It is also the fastest-growing database ecosystem, and boasts hundreds of millions of downloads.
